4.数据类型

# 数据类型 --- 再python里为了应对不同的业务需求,也把数据分为不同的类型
# type()函数可以识别变量的数据类型
# 1.数值 --- 在python中没有长度限制
# 1.1 整型(int)
#     int类型有二(0b/0B),八(0o/0O),十,十六(0x/0X)进制这四种计数方式
a = 1
print(a) # 1
print(type(a)) # <class 'int'>
# 1.2 浮点型 --- 就是小数(含有小数点的数)
b = 1.0
print(b) # 1.0
print(type(b)) # <class 'float'>

# 2.布尔类型(bool)
# 该类型只有两个值True(真)和False(假)
# 对应True的值 :True,1(或非0数值)
# 对应False的值:False, None,任何空数字类型的0(0,0.0,0j),任何空序列("",[],()),空字典

# 3.字符串类型 --- str
#  字符串是由一个单引号、双引号或者三引号包裹的有序的字符集合
string = "adf" #给字符串赋值
print(string) #adf

# 4.列表类型 --- list
# 列表是多个元素的集合,它可以保存任意数量、任意类型的元素,且可以被修改
# python中可以使用[]创建列表,列表中的元素以都好分隔
list = [12,35,457] #创建一个列表
print(list) #[12, 35, 457]

# 5.元组类型 --- tuple
# 元组与列表相似,可以保存任意数量、任意类型的元素,但不能被修改。
# python中可以使用()创建元组,元组中的元素以逗号分隔
tuple = (12,35,57) #创建一个元组
print(tuple) #(12, 35, 57)

# 6.集合类型 --- set
# 集合与列表、元组相似,可以保存任意数量、任意类型的元素,但集合中的元素唯一且无序
# python中可以使用{}创建集合,集合中的元素以逗号分隔
set = {12,55,55,33,26,55} #创建一个集合
print(set) #{33, 26, 12, 55}

# 7.字典类型 --- dist
# 字典中的元素是“键(key):值(value)”形式的键值对,键不能重复。
# python中可以使用{}创建字典,字典中的键值对以逗号分隔
dist = {'name':'张三','age':'18'} #创建一个字典
print(dist) #{'name': '张三', 'age': '18'}

a = {} #注:这创建的是一个字典,而非集合

  • 2
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值